Three Primary Plastic Welding Technologies: Characteristics and Applications
| Technology Type | Material Thickness Range | Primary Applications | Typical Power Range | Key Advantages | Limitations |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Hot Air Welding | 1-5mm thin sheets | Geomembranes, PVC roofing, tarpaulins, automotive interior trim | 1500W-3500W | Portable, versatile, lower equipment cost, good for field repairs | Slower welding speed, requires operator skill for consistent results |
| Ultrasonic Welding | 0.5-3mm small parts | Electronics housings, medical devices, automotive components, packaging | 500W-4000W (15/20/35kHz frequency) | Fast cycle time (0.1-1 sec), clean welds, automated production ready | Higher equipment cost, limited to thermoplastics with compatible acoustic properties |
| Extrusion Welding | 5-50mm thick sections | Storage tanks, chemical containers, pipe systems, structural components | 3000W-8000W | High deposition rate, strong welds on thick materials, vertical welding capability | Larger equipment footprint, higher power consumption, requires filler rod |
| Butt Fusion Welding | 20-50mm pipes and fittings | Water/gas pipelines, industrial piping systems, tank fabrication | 2000W-6000W | Creates monolithic joints, DVS 2207 certified processes, ideal for pressure systems | Limited to pipe/fitting geometries, requires precise alignment fixtures |
A critical insight from technical documentation is that these welding technologies are complementary rather than substitutable. A buyer purchasing equipment for 2mm automotive interior trim will not consider extrusion welders designed for 30mm tank fabrication, and vice versa. Only identical thermoplastics can be welded homogeneously. While all thermoplastics are technically weldable, PTFE (Teflon) is a notable exception due to its molecular structure. Material compatibility testing is essential before production [5].
